Hello, List!  There are two Personal Folders icons in the folder list of
Outlook 2003 that are un-openable and un-deletable.  They do not appear in
the Data Management folders list and even Properties will not open.  They
are not causing any problems, they are just an eyesore.  I believe they are
corrupt files that lost their links after being moved around and upgraded
from an older version of Outlook. When clicked on, a message pops up that
says the file cannot be opened.  The rest of Outlook and all the other .pst
files are healthy and functional.  I would run scanpst on them but I cannot
locate them anywhere outside of the Folders List in Outlook.  Any ideas on
how to get rid of them?  Thanks!  Lyz
